About Shanlin Yang
Shanlin Yang is a scholar working on Management Science and Operations Research, Industrial and Manufacturing Engineering, Management Information Systems, Artificial Intelligence and Information Systems, having authored 351 papers that have together received 12.1k indexed citations. Recurring topics across this work include Multi-Criteria Decision Making (56 papers), Scheduling and Optimization Algorithms (45 papers), Energy Load and Power Forecasting (37 papers), Advanced Manufacturing and Logistics Optimization (36 papers), Smart Grid Energy Management (36 papers), Rough Sets and Fuzzy Logic (26 papers), Energy, Environment, Economic Growth (19 papers) and Grey System Theory Applications (16 papers). The work is most often cited by research in Management Science and Operations Research (2.2k citations), Industrial and Manufacturing Engineering (1.1k citations), Management Information Systems (890 citations), Energy Engineering and Power Technology (278 citations) and Renewable Energy, Sustainability and the Environment (1.4k citations). Shanlin Yang has collaborated with scholars based in China, United States and Hong Kong. Frequent co-authors include Kaile Zhou, Kaile Zhou, Chao Fu, Shuai Ding, Xinhui Lu, Zhen Shao, Chi Zhang, Lulu Wen, YU Jun-qing and Yong‐Wu Zhou. Their work appears in journals such as Renewable and Sustainable Energy Reviews, Journal of Cleaner Production, Knowledge-Based Systems, Expert Systems with Applications and European Journal of Operational Research.
